Why Cars Are the Core Experience of FH6

FH6 Credits MmoGah

In Forza Horizon 6, cars are far more than just a means of transportation. They are your key to exploring the open world of Japan, your ticket to every race, and the most personal way to express your style. The game features over 550 officially licensed Forza Horizon 6 Cars — from iconic JDM legends like the AE86 and GT-R R32 to top-tier hypercars such as the Ferrari J50 and Lamborghini. Each vehicle represents a unique driving style and collectible value.

However, not every car comes easily. Some limited-edition cars are locked behind seasonal playlists, specific event progression, or intense bidding at the Auction House. For players with limited time, this often means long waits or repetitive grinding.

In-Depth Guide: Three Main Ways to Get FH6 Cars

🏪 Autoshow Purchase

• Best for: Regular production cars.

• Pros: Instant access, fixed price.

• Cons: Top-tier cars are extremely expensive.

📅 Seasonal Playlists & Event Challenges

• Best for: Weekly exclusive cars.

• Pros: Free to earn, often comes with special liveries.

• Cons: Very time-consuming; missing a week may mean losing access for a long time.

🏷️ Auction House

• Best for: Discontinued cars, rare models, perfectly tuned builds.

• Pros: Prices fluctuate; you can sometimes find great deals.

• Cons: Popular cars get pricey; beginners may be "sniped".

Frequently Asked Questions (Forza Horizon 6 Cars FAQ)

Q1: What are the most sought-after limited cars in FH6?

The most discussed limited-edition cars among players include the Ferrari J50 (pre-order reward, now discontinued), the Toyota Supra '20 (Season 1 Level 20 reward), and the AE86 Trueno (unlocked through specific events). These cars are often heavily overpriced on the Auction House and remain in high demand.

Q3: Can FH6 cars be transferred across platforms?

Yes. FH6 supports cross-save. Any car you obtain on Xbox, PC, or PS will automatically sync to your account. This means you can access your vehicles on any platform, regardless of where you acquired or purchased them.

Q4: What should I do first after getting a new car?

It's recommended to apply basic tuning and a livery first, then enter events that match the car's performance class. For collection-focused cars, you can simply store them in your garage for display. For performance cars, prioritize upgrading tires, brakes, and the drivetrain — these offer the best value for improving handling and overall performance.

Q5: Why can't I find certain cars in the Autoshow?

The Autoshow only sells regular production cars. All seasonal limited cars, event reward cars, and pre-order exclusive cars are not available for direct purchase at the Autoshow. They can only be obtained through seasonal events, the Auction House, or third-party channels.
